The Type XS Common Mode Power Line Choke with NiZn ferrite core is designed for high-frequency EMI suppression in modern power electronic systems. Compared with standard MnZn-based chokes, the NiZn material offers better performance at higher frequencies, making it ideal for switching power supplies with fast switching speeds.
This component effectively suppresses common-mode noise on AC power lines while maintaining minimal impact on differential signals. It is widely used in compact power systems where both EMI compliance and space efficiency are critical.
Its compact XS-type structure allows easy integration into densely populated PCB layouts, while ensuring stable filtering performance and long-term reliability.

Physical Properties
| Order Code | IR (A) | L (μH) | RDC max. (mΩ) | VR (V(AC)) | VT (V(AC)) |
| INF-Type XS-100μH | 1.5 | 100 | 80 | 250 | 1500 |
| INF-Type XS-47μH | 2 | 47 | 40 | 250 | 1500 |
| INF-Type XS-30μH | 3 | 30 | 26 | 250 | 1500 |
| NF-Type XS-14μH | 4 | 14 | 15 | 250 | 1500 |
